Thumbs down Starting issue plus weird smell

Ok so I have been having this starting issue on and off for a while now. When I try and start it all the power turns on but not the engine and it takes me like 4 or 5 tries to get it. And now for about a week or two Ive been noticing a kinda burning smell coming from the rear of my vehicle, from the inside and outside. Any ideas?? Sounds like you're starter motor is going bad, the burning smell is most likely the insulation in the starter smoking from the heat.

Take your HHR to an auto parts store where they can do a check on it for you, most will do it free of charge. If it is the starter plan on it letting you sit somewhere, so have it fixed A.S.A.P.
